Jump threat man talked down from Rochester Bridge

A man was talked down from Rochester Bridge by police last night after threatening to jump.

The 39-year-old was spotted standing on the Strood-bound carriageway shortly before 8pm and a worried member of the public called the police.

Officers closed the bridge so they could speak to him and get him to safety almost an hour later.

A Kent Police spokesman said: “The man was removed from the bridge and it was reopened at approximately 8.49pm. The man was taken to hospital for precautionary measures.”
